Runbook: AgriLink Gateway Restart. When the Harrow-9 telemetry gateway at the Velden test farm stops forwarding tractor CAN frames, first confirm the uplink daemon is running and that the buffer directory is below 80% capacity. Then recreate /etc/agrilink/gateway.env with the region set to velden-east and the flush interval at 30 seconds. On the next line, add the broker credential exactly as issued.

sealed setting: ARCHIVE_KEY3=8d0

**Mgmt Meeting Minutes — Retiring the Brightline Range**

Quick recap for sales leads at Fenholt Supplies: we agreed to retire the Brightline fixture range by year-end. Remaining stock moves to clearance pricing next month, and accounts on standing orders get migrated to the Lumetta range. Trade-in incentives were approved in principle. The confidential note on next steps sits just below.

board note of bajof-bajeg: The pricing group signed off on a budget of $13.4 million for Project Sildor. The renewal with Lamixek Holdings closes at $48.9 million a year, 49 percent above the last contract.

**Action Item 4: Rate limit visibility for support**

During the Quillgate incident, support folks had no way to tell whether a customer was being throttled by the internal gateway or just hitting a genuinely broken endpoint. That cost us about two hours of back-and-forth. We're adding a per-tenant rate-limit dashboard so you can check throttle status yourself before escalating to the Gateway team. Marta owns this, due end of sprint. Once it ships, you'll find the dashboard here.

operations page: https://confluence.qorvellabs.internal/pages/projects/projects/projects

## Formula sandbox tuning

User-supplied formulas in Gridmoor execute inside a restricted interpreter with hard ceilings on time, memory, and call depth. Reviewers should confirm any change to these ceilings is justified in the PR description, since raising them widens the abuse surface. Defaults were chosen from production traces. The current limits are as follows.

limits module of tafog-fawip:
WEIGHTS = {
    "julix": 57,
    "lamys": 992,
    "kasvan": 209,
    "quenok": 750,
    "alddor": 259,
    "oliath": 1009,
    "wenix": 815,
}